January Weather in Truro, Australia

Last updated: August 22, 2025

The average temperature in Truro, Australia during January is a pleasant 23°C (73°F). However, temperatures can range from a cool 9°C (49°F) to an intense 45°C (113°F). Expect a modest precipitation of 13 mm (0.5 in) over approximately 2 days, with an average humidity level of 41%.

January Temperature in Truro

In January in Truro, the average temperature is 23°C (73°F). Maximums can reach 45°C (113°F) and minimums can be as low as 9°C (49°F). Travelers should be prepared for a wide range of temperatures and plan accordingly for both hot days and cooler evenings.

January UV Index in Truro

In Truro in January, the maximum UV index is 14, which corresponds to an extreme Exposure Category. The time to burn is just 10 minutes, so it's crucial to take precautions. For the detailed hourly UV index in Truro, you can check here.

How January Weather in Truro Compares to Other Months

Weather in Truro var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ares January’s weather to other months in Truro,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Truro, showing how January’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ather23°C (73°F)13 mm (0.5 inches)41%extreme
February Weather21°C (70°F)19 mm (0.8 inches)46%extreme
March Weather20°C (68°F)7 mm (0.3 inches)55%extreme
April Weather16°C (62°F)20 mm (0.8 inches)66%very high
May Weather12°C (54°F)23 mm (0.9 inches)73%moderate
June Weather9°C (49°F)24 mm (1.0 inches)76%moderate
July Weather10°C (50°F)25 mm (1.0 inches)76%moderate
August Weather10°C (50°F)38 mm (1.5 inches)70%moderate
September Weather13°C (55°F)24 mm (0.9 inches)65%very high
October Weather16°C (60°F)24 mm (0.9 inches)51%very high
November Weather18°C (65°F)28 mm (1.1 inches)50%extreme
December Weather21°C (70°F)12 mm (0.5 inches)46%extreme
